[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I’m posting raw score info here because it may help another poster in the future as I could find barely anything when we were test prepping and I was grading my kid’s practice tests. My kid got 255/298 on the HSPT and the way it was weighted resulted in a 96th percentile composite score. Hope this helps. [/quote] That’s because it varies from year to year depending on how kids do across the country for that particular year. But I would guess the numbers aren’t too dissimilar from year to year. My kid got a 279/298 and scored a 99. But all 99’s aren’t created equal. There are further breakdowns that can differentiate same percentage scores. The trickiest part is that not every school asks for the various levels of details so one schools results can look different compared to another. [/quote]
